Sr. Speech Pathologist Full-time, Day shift
On-siteStockton, California, United States
Job Summary
Conduct comprehensive evaluations of speech, language, cognition, swallowing, voice, and auditory functions to establish individualized treatment and discharge plans. Deliver therapy interventions using established protocols, provide education and training to staff on technical skills, and serve as a technical specialist for daily cases. Complete accurate clinical documentation within deadlines and communicate effectively with physicians and other health professionals. Maintain departmental in-service standards and participate in assigned special projects. Requires Master's degree, state licensure, CCC-SLP certification, and BLS/CPR certification.
Required Qualifications
- Master's Degree or foreign equivalent
- Speech Pathologist licensure in the state of practice
- Cardiopulmonary Resuscitation (CPR) certification or Basic Life Support (BLS) certification from approved vendor per AH policy
- Basic Life Support (BLS) certification from approved vendor per AH policy
- Certificate of Clinical Competence in Speech-Language Pathology (CCC-SLP)
- All required vaccinations
- Access to and reading of E-Verify Participation and Right to Work notices
Desired Qualifications
- Three years' technical experience
- American Speech-Language and Hearing Association (ASHA) Certificate of Clinical Competence (CCC)
